An album that really lives up to its title – as the record sets out to prove to the world that Isaiah Collier is one of the most almighty talents on the saxophone in recent years! The album has a spiritual majesty that tops even the previous album with the Chosen Few group – as in addition to work from the quartet that includes Julian Davis Reid on piano, Jeremiah Hunt on bass, and Michael Shekwoaga Ode on drums – the group adds in extra instrumentation, light strings, and added horns at times too – all of which push the music into territory that's right up there with Nimbus or Strata East back in the glory days! Collier is a true jazz visionary, and his message here is bold and brilliant – given some key support from older Chicago legends who include saxophonist Ari Brown on one track, and vocalist Dee Alexander on another – getting maybe one of her most beautiful showcases ever on record. Titles include "Love", "Compassion", "Duality Suite", "The Almighty", and "Perspective (Peace & Love)". CD

A very cool group headed by percussionist Hamid Drake – one that features some deeply soulful work from the contemporary Chicago underground! There's a more righteous feel to the set than some of Drake's other recordings – a quality that stretches back to the Chicago scene of the 70s, with complex interplay between a range of different sounds and spirits – performed by a lineup that includes Joe Morris on guitar and banjo, Jeff Parker on guitar, William Parker and Josh Abrams on basses and percussion, and Dee Alexander on vocals – adding in some surprising wonderful elements to the record! Alexander's vocals almost remind us of some of Dee Dee Bridgewater's more outside expressions from her earliest years in the 70s – a very soulful fit for the group, and one that moves it past the usual improvisational combo. Titles include "The Beautiful Name", "There Is Nothing Left But You", "My Blissful Mother", "Visions Of Ma", "Supreme Lady Victorious In Battle", and "Playful Dance At Soma". CD

Lezlie Harrison's a great singer, and she sounds especially wonderful here next to the Hammond B3 of Ben Paterson – a player who really seems to click with Lezlie's great approach! There's a slight current of soul in Harrison's music, but the music is definitely jazz – as she's got a richness of expression, and way of using her voice that we'd rank right up there with vocalists like Carmen Lundy or Dee Alexander – given plenty of space to open up and soar here in a small combo setting, with work also from Matt Chertkoff on guitar and Pete Zimmer on drums. The approach is great – very different than some straight old school Hammond/vocal session – as Harrison's take on the tunes is very fresh, with more contemporary approach to arrangements – on titles that include "Love Won't Let Me Wait", "Let Them Talk", "A Lover Is Forever", "What A Little Moonlight Can Do", "Fly Like An Eagle", and "Close Your Eyes". A sublime combination of strings from this unique Chicago trio – an group that features Tomeka Reid on cello, Mazz Swift on violin, and Silvia Bolognesi on bass – all coming together in modes that differ nicely from previous string trios in avant jazz! The players aren't afraid to draw on more melodic elements of their instruments when needed, but almost always offset that quality with some sharper or more experimental elements too – sometimes not in a noisy way, but just to open up their instruments to a range of very fresh possibilities – and hardly at all like any "strings" jazz you might expect! Dee Alexander sings guest vocals on the beautiful track "Not Living In Fear" – and all other selections are instrumental, with titles that include "Terrortoma", "Leaving Livorno", "Transiti", "Requiem For Charlie Haden", "Last Night's Vacation", and "Cantiere Orlando". A soul jazz masterpiece – and one of the rarest albums on the Jazzland label! Tenorist Joe Alexander has a mean, raw tone on the set – clearly influenced by the early 60s soul jazz generation, but also with some nicely off-beat tones that give him a really unique feel. He's backed here by the kind of a group that couldn't go wrong – Bobby Timmons on piano, Sam Jones on bass, and Albert Heath on drums – as well as the equally-obscure John Hunt on flugelhorn. Tracks are all long and jamming – much more soulful than some of the other Jazzland sides from the time – with titles that include "I'll Close My Eyes", "Brown's Town", "Terri's Blues", and "Weird Beard". A rare moment in the major label spotlight for George Coleman – an early 90s session for Verve, and one that should have gotten him the same sort of ongoing recognition as contemporary sessions at the label by JJ Johnson, Randy Weston, and Joe Henderson! The format here is spare, but nicely varied – with Coleman on a tenor, soprano, and alto saxes alongside a trio of Harold Mabern on piano, Ray Drummond on bass, and Billy Higgins on drums. With a rhythm section that strong, you could almost throw just about any player up against them and get something great – but Coleman's also really pushing to the forefront of the tunes on most numbers, blowing with a deep voice and strong sound that almost recalls some of the work that Eric Alexander did in later years with Mabern. Titles include "Old Folks", "Lush Life", "Conrad", "My Romance", "You Mean So Much To Me", and "The Sheik Of Araby". CD

A double-length set from Chicago tenorist Chris Greene – but a package that may well not be enough to hold all the new ideas in his music! We've really watched Chris grow strongly over the past few years – and with this wonderfully well-crafted, rich-voiced album, he steps forward to a level that rivals some of the much bigger saxophone talents recording these days for labels like High Note or Criss Cross! Greene's always had a deep tone in his horns – one that draws from a Chicago tradition, but inflects it with some of the more contemporary modes of later players on the scene – like Eric Alexander, who Chris might be approaching with this set. The range of rhythms and song styles is great – never gimmicky, but expanding past standard expectations – so that Greene's group is playing Coltrane and Wayne Shorter one minute, then Martin Denny the next, then Ed Motta, then a huge batch of their own great compositions as well. Instrumentation is simple – Chris on saxes, plus piano or keyboards, bass, and drums – but there's some wide voices here that really make the album compelling – and the longer length very necessary to contain it all. Titles include "Firecracker", "Deluge", "Day of Honor", "Divers", "Solution", "Papuera", "Clean & Clear", "Institutional Samba", and "Nostalgia In Times Square". CD

At the end of the 60s, Milt Jackson and Ray Brown cut some very groovy records together – teamed up in a great pairing of styles that pushed both of them way past the more standard sounds of earlier years! This album's one of the best of the bunch – as it features pianist Monty Alexander joining the pair, bringing in some warmly soulful elements on piano – in ways that are a great bridge between his work for MGM and MPS! The set also features great tenor from Teddy Edwards – blowing with a deep tone and a sharp edge – and in addition to vibes by Jackson and bass by Brown, the group also features Dick Berk on drums. The set was recorded live at Shelly's Manne-Hole – and titles include Alexander's "That's The Way It Is", plus "Blues In The Basement", "Wheelin & Dealin", and "Tenderly". LP, Vinyl record album

A sweet live set from guitarist Pat Martino – recorded with a nice gritty feel, and just the right blend of organ and tenor that Pat would get on his Prestige Records dates of the 60s! The tracks are all nice and long, with the kind of open, freewheeling energy that we love back in the 60s soul jazz days when Martino got his start – and as on some other excellent recent dates, the move back to basics works perfectly for Pat's deep talents on the guitar – augmented nicely here by organ lines form Tony Monaco, and some especially tight tenor from Eric Alexander. The group's completed by drummer Jeff Tain Watts – and titles include "Lean Years", "Inside Out", "Side Effect", "Goin To A Meeting", and "Double Play". CD

One of the best of the early 60s comeback albums by the legendary bop trumpeter Howard McGhee – and a record that really has the player finding a whole new groove in his music! At this point, Maggie's got a fantastic tone that was missing from his earlier records, filled with pain and raw emotion – but also measured with a maturity that gives his solos an incredible sense of economy that delivers a whole hell of a lot with just a few simple notes – a balance that comes through beautifully here, maybe even more so than on any other record by Howard from the time! He's playing here in a great group that includes Roland Alexander on tenor, Bennie Green on trombone, Tommy Flanagan on piano, and Pepper Adams on baritone – and tracks include "Dusty Blue", "Groovin High", "Cottage For Sale", "Flyin Colors", and "With Malice Towards None". Sublime guitar work from the great Johnny Smith – a musician who was years ahead of his time, and influenced a generation with his clean, clear tone on the instrument! Smith's in a perfect setting here – a Roost label quartet date that includes Bob Pancost on piano, George Roumanis on bass, and Mousie Alexander on drums – a very understated group that really lets Johnny's wonderful tones and colors stand strongly out front! Titles include "0500 Blues", "Old Girl", "Tired Blood", "Un Poco Loco", and "More Bass". LP, Vinyl record album

A soulful little album from saxophonist Grant Stewart – one that's made even better by the appearance of Eric Alexander on two of the tracks in the set! The core group here features guitar, piano, bass, and drums – with Stewart in the lead, blowing tenor in a deep-toned way that clearly draws on the legacy of Hank Mobley, but which also moves around with a leaner, more fluid sensibility at times. The ballads and mellower numbers are often the best – especially the album's great title reading of "Estate" – but the uptempo tracks move along in a nice hardbop mode too, and titles include "Carving The Rock", "Soul Station", "Jacqueline", and "Cool Struttin". Alexander guests on the titles "3 For Carson" and "Systems" – making for a nice twin-tenor frontline! CD

Jack Teagarden sings and swings on trombone – that unique groove that was a key updating of his trad style in these later years! As you might guess from the title, the album's made mostly of tunes from spiritual sources – swung in tighter jazzy styles by arranger Van Alexander, who brings in some occasional vocal chorus bits from time to time – sung by doo wop legends The Five Keys! But Jack's almost always in the lead – hitting a crackling, honest sort of warmth, whether on vocals or trombone – on titles that include "This Train", "Swing Low, Sweet Chariot", "Sing & Shout", "Deep River", and "Goin Home".
